Engine Requirements



Outfitted with a robust layout, the VQ35 engine in the Nissan Murano supplies a mix of power and efficiency that improves the SUV's efficiency. This 3.5-liter V6 engine is engineered with a light weight aluminum alloy block and aluminum DOHC (Twin Overhead Camera) cylinder heads, adding to its lightweight qualities while ensuring longevity. The VQ35 engine supplies a maximum result of about 245 horsepower at 6,000 RPM and a torque score of around 246 lb-ft at 4,400 RPM, helping with solid acceleration and responsiveness.


Incorporating advanced innovations, the VQ35 features continual variable shutoff timing (CVVT) on both the consumption and exhaust sides. This development enhances engine efficiency throughout numerous RPM ranges, improving both power delivery and gas effectiveness. In addition, the engine uses a multi-port gas injection system, making certain accurate gas atomization for boosted combustion.


The VQ35 is mated to a continually variable transmission (CVT), which gives seamless gear transitions and enhances driving convenience. Overall, the requirements of the VQ35 engine exhibit Nissan's commitment to efficiency and integrity, making it an important characteristic for the Murano SUV.

Dependability and Upkeep



Integrity is a vital consideration for SUV owners, and the VQ35 engine in the Nissan Murano demonstrates a strong performance history in this respect. This engine, known for its robust building and design quality, has actually amassed favorable reviews from both consumers and automotive professionals alike. With a style that highlights sturdiness, the VQ35 has shown durability against typical deterioration, adding to its track record as a reputable powertrain.


Regular maintenance is vital to ensure the longevity of the VQ35 engine. Regular oil adjustments, generally recommended every 5,000 to 7,500 miles, are important for maintaining optimum efficiency and stopping engine wear. Furthermore, keeping an eye on coolant levels and replacing the timing belt at the defined periods can dramatically improve the engine's integrity.


While the VQ35 has less reported concerns compared to some competitors, it is Your Domain Name not unsusceptible to prospective difficulties, such as oil leaks or sensor failures. However, proactive upkeep and resolving minor issues without delay can minimize these problems.
